My Buying Guides on Alpha Lipid Acid Cream
What I Look for Before Buying
When I shop for an alpha lipid acid cream, I first check what skin concern I want to address. I look for a product that matches my needs, whether that is dryness, dullness, rough texture, or signs of aging. I also pay attention to the ingredient list, because I want a cream that feels effective but still gentle on my skin.
Ingredients I Prefer
I always read the label carefully. I prefer creams with supportive ingredients like hyaluronic acid, ceramides, glycerin, and soothing botanicals. If the product includes alpha lipoic acid, I want it in a balanced formula so my skin does not feel irritated. For my skin, fewer harsh additives usually means better results.
Skin Type Compatibility
My skin type matters a lot when I choose a cream. If my skin feels sensitive, I look for a fragrance-free and non-comedogenic formula. If my skin is dry, I want something richer and more moisturizing. For oily or combination skin, I usually choose a lighter texture that absorbs quickly without leaving a greasy finish.
Texture and Absorption
I pay close attention to how the cream feels on my skin. I prefer a smooth texture that spreads easily and absorbs well. If a cream feels too heavy or sticky, I know I probably will not enjoy using it every day. A good alpha lipid acid cream should feel comfortable enough for regular use.
Packaging and Shelf Life
I also consider the packaging because it can affect product quality. I like air-tight or opaque containers since they help protect active ingredients from light and air. I check the expiration date and storage instructions too, because I want the cream to stay effective for as long as possible.
Brand Reputation and Reviews
Before I buy, I usually read customer reviews and look into the brand’s reputation. I trust products more when other users report good results and few side effects. I also prefer brands that are transparent about their ingredients and testing practices.
How I Test It Safely
Whenever I try a new cream, I patch test it first. I apply a small amount to a discreet area of my skin and wait to see how it reacts. This helps me avoid unnecessary irritation, especially if the formula contains active ingredients.
